CVE-2003-1361: Unknown vulnerability in VERITAS Bare Metal Restore (BMR) of Tivoli Storage Manager (TSM) 3.1.0 through 3.2...

Unknown vulnerability in VERITAS Bare Metal Restore (BMR) of Tivoli Storage Manager (TSM) 3.1.0 through 3.2.1 allows remote attackers to gain root privileges on the BMR Main Server.

This is an old but high-impact issue: a remote attacker could gain root privileges on a VERITAS BMR Main Server used with Tivoli Storage Manager. The public record does not explain the bug mechanics or confirm exploitation. Business urgency depends on whether this legacy BMR component still exists and is reachable. Exposure is likely limited to legacy environments running VERITAS Bare Metal Restore with Tivoli Storage Manager 3.1.0 through 3.2.1, especially if the BMR Main Server is network reachable. The supplied affected-product metadata is incomplete, so inventory confirmation is essential. Treat as critical if the legacy BMR Main Server exists. Remote root compromise can mean full server takeover, but the age and sparse public detail make exposure validation the first priority before broad emergency action. Mitigation focus: Identify any VERITAS BMR Main Server tied to Tivoli Storage Manager 3.1.0 through 3.2.1.; Review the referenced VERITAS advisory documents for vendor-approved fixes or workarounds.; Restrict network access to any affected BMR Main Server while guidance is confirmed..
